I love PDF! Have only ever done 2 separate day trips there but it is probably worth staying for 2 days if you want to see anything, it is impossible to see it all in 1 day. You can download the programme the night before which will help with an itinerary, but don't underestimate how long it takes to traverse the park and the queues. You will need to queue for the most popular shows for about an hour before, so take a baguette/drink and eat in the queue. If you want to eat lunch/dinner in restaurants, it's best to book. Are you going to the cinescene too?

Not sure what else there is in the area, but if you're prepared to travel before/after I would look at Nantes, or the western Loire- Amboise/Saumur?
